The 5 Biggest Ad Campaign Mistakes Businesses Make

1. Targeting Too Broad or Irrelevant Audiences

If you sell sarees in Bhubaneswar but your ads are reaching audiences in Delhi, you’re burning your budget. Local targeting is key for Odisha businesses.

2. Not Tracking Conversions

Clicks mean nothing if you can’t see how many turned into leads or sales. Without conversion tracking, you’re driving blind.

3. Ignoring Ad Copy Testing

One boring, generic ad running for months? That’s a recipe for ad fatigue. Testing different headlines, images, and CTAs is essential.

4. Skipping Negative Keywords in Google Ads

If you’re selling “luxury hotels” but your ad shows up for “cheap hotel rooms,” you’re paying for the wrong clicks. Negative keywords filter out junk traffic.

5. Relying Only on ‘Boost Post’

Boosting a Facebook post is fine for awareness, but it’s not a proper sales-focused ad campaign. It lacks the targeting depth you need for real ROI.

How to Spot If Your Ads Are Wasting Money

  • Your clicks are high, but sales are low
  • You’re getting traffic from cities you don’t serve
  • Your cost-per-click keeps going up, but conversions stay the same
  • Your CPM (cost per 1,000 views) is high, but you’re not getting engagement

If even one of these is true, your budget is leaking.

Local Success Story – From Loss to Profit

A small electronics retailer in Bhubaneswar came to me after spending ₹25,000 in ads without a single sale.

  • Problem: Broad targeting, no negative keywords, no clear CTA.
  • Fix: Hyper-local targeting (within 10 km), high-intent keywords, and a strong offer.
  • Result: 40% less spend, triple the sales within 30 days.
